First up is a set of cute tags using the new Little Linked Labels stamp set, embossing folder & coordinating die.
I love that you can dry emboss or heat emboss in gold, white or simply stamp with black or tone on tone ink onto solid colored cardstock for many different looks.

Next up is the Large Linked Labels stamp set, embossing folder & die. These have the same idea as the ones above but a larger size which is perfect for labeling handmade gifts, but also packages, envelopes and more. You can also see that I added a few bows in the photo using the new Regency Bow No. 2 die set.
This next card uses several new sets mixed with previously released. For the background I layered one of the new Capsule Filigree Borders onto one of the Capsule Basics die cuts. Behind the Capsule Filigree die cut is a green panel that was embossed using the Shortbread Shapes: Snowflakes Embossing Folder. The bloom die cut is featuring the new Bigger Holiday Botanicals: Amaryllis die set. I used the new Regency Bow No. 2 die set for the bow. For the sentiment I used the Rosemal Reflections stamp and die set.

This next card mixes old and new as well. For the background I used Diamond Ribbons Die. I used the Capsule Basics Dies for the two oval panels and stamped the greenery using the new Capsule Collection Holiday Borders Stamp Set. For the bloom I used the new Bigger Holiday Botanicals: Poinsettia die set. I used the Capsule Quick Tags for the sentiment and the Hang it Up die for the matte gold hanger on top.
This last card features the Shortbread Shapes: Snowflake Embossing Folder & Die. The detail on this embossing folder is incredible. I added a bow using the new Regency Bow No. 2 die and for the sentiment I used the Scripted Holiday Sentiments Stamp & Die Set.
